My struggle with having Archbold so high is will they have to find a new identity and go back to being more of an RPO team focused more on the run and quick passes or do they feel they have a QB ready to step in and keep trying to run the system like Newman is back there. Archbold was down 35-21 to Liberty Center with around 6:00 left and it took Newman 2 minutes to put together 130 yards of offense and kicked a perfect onside kick to tie things up before LC drove 70 yards to kick the last second field goal. I'm not even sure their RB had positive yards rushing in that game so It's hard to see how good they will be without Newman and their two very good receivers.
